WOMEN FIRST AND MEN SECOND AT HBCU CHALLENGE
10.2.16 | Men's Cross Country, Women's Cross Country
CARY, N.C. – The Hampton University cross country teams competed on Saturday at the Robert Shumake HBCU Challenge and came away with top two finishes. The Lady Pirates won their 17-team 5k race, while the men took second in the 16-team 8k race.
The victory for the Lady Pirates was their first in a race since the Panther Invitational on October 10, 2014.
All five scoring runners for Hampton finished in the top ten as freshman Alycia Higgins took fourth place to lead Hampton covering the 5k course at the Wake Medical Soccer Park in 19:35.4. Pollyanna Velasco was sixth in 19:40.0 while Amanda Delacruz was eighth in 19:58.0. Rounding out the top 10 was Kayla Key in ninth in a time of 20:07.3 and Asia Johnson in tenth at 20:08.4.
Hampton scored 37 points to win the women's title with North Carolina A&T State in second (59), Winston-Salem State (70) and Morgan State (116) rounding out the top four.
On the men's side Emmanuel Too was the top runner for Hampton finishing fourth covering the 8k course in 25:42.7. Stanley Davis was 12th in 27:00.3, while Tayvon Burress was 21st in 28:08.8. Rounding out the five Hampton runners was Eric Ellis in 39th in 30:03.5 and Khalil Gary in 61st in 31:46.4.
In the 16-team, 115-runner field, North Carolina A&T State won the men's side scoring 47 points while Hampton came in second with 70. Morehouse was third with 76 points, while Benedict rounded out the top four with 100.
The next race for Hampton will keep them locally as the team will compete in the Christopher Newport University Invitational on October 15.
